Job Purpose
Coordinates and oversees service operations executed by Technical Service Personnel, ensuring the successful installation, testing, repair, and maintenance of new and reworked TechnipFMC and other branded equipment and tools under field conditions—both onshore and offshore. This includes job preparation and delivery in international environments. The role also involves personally performing installations when required, while optimizing QHSES performance and ensuring full compliance with applicable policies and regulations at all work sites.
Job Description
- Coordinate field service operations, ensuring alignment with established sales targets, cost budgets, and delivery schedules.
- Ensure all equipment, service tooling, backup, and spare parts are present on location, ready for use, and function-fit prior to job start.
- Accurately prepare and submit field service reports, job logs, and all required documentation, including part and serial numbers, equipment types, and non-conformance reports (FNCRs).
- Record and document critical technical data such as dimensions, weights, temperatures, pressures, and flow rates to support product testing, operation, and assembly reviews.
- Maintain high-level communication with internal and external stakeholders to ensure clarity on job procedures, parts requirements, and critical measurements; proactively suggest safety and operational improvements.
- Provide sales support by ensuring customers are fully informed of all aspects of the job and by handling customer complaints professionally.
- Serve as a professional representative of TechnipFMC, identifying opportunities for business improvement and customer success.
- Complete all safety-related documentation and consistently promote and pursue safe work practices.
- Uphold TechnipFMC Quality Management System requirements and enforce adherence to QHSE and the company code of ethics.
- Complete Field Non-Conformance Reports (E-FNCR) and ensure all equipment and procedural defects are communicated back to the TechnipFMC Project Manager.
- Report daily to the Service Project Manager on project execution and escalate business-critical decisions related to operations, customer issues, or personnel matters; support Management of Change (MOC) processes.
- Act as an ambassador for TechnipFMC, continuously striving to improve safety, technical knowledge, professionalism, and customer success.
- Mentor or instruct less experienced team members and/or customers in and out of the field; conduct training and competency assessments of junior Field Service Technicians (FSTs).
- Maintain monthly reporting on P&L financials and contribute to financial forecasting based on current backlog and estimated job completion dates.
- Review and approve Field Service Orders and in-country invoices to ensure accuracy and compliance.
- Maintain and develop strong relationships with clients, agents, and suppliers to support operational success.
- Visit clients to review operations and issue notices when activities exceed contractual scope.
- Ensure all organizational activities and operations are compliant with internal policies and applicable laws and regulations.
